|
|
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
Доброго дня! Есть задача : создать базу данных по ремонту электронных устройств. База будет сосотять из одной таблицы. Данные повторяющиеся. Столбцы: 0.п/п 1.описание неисправности (несколько разновидностей) 2. что сделано по ремонту (несколько разновидностей) 3.год выпуска (2009 - 2013) 4.наличие пломбы (есть/нет) 5.примечание (плата1/плата2) ... и т.д. дальше столбцы с неповторяющимися данными Т.к. я не имею опыта в этом деле нужен Ваш профессиональный совет: Как это реализуется "по правилам хорошего тона" ? Правильно ли будет сделать что-то типа справочника в котором будут разновидности неисправностей, ремонта, годы, состояния пломбы... и т.д. , каждой записи присвоить уникальный код. И чтоб в базе хранились эти соответствующие коды. Или правильно всетаки хранить в базе сами слова? Заранее сп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:08 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
http://www.sql.ru/forum/actualtopics.aspx?bid=36 Модератор: Тема перенесена из форума "Microsoft SQL Server". 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:10 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
fargutvest, не сочтите за грубость, хорошим тоном будет купить книжку "разработка приложений на [любой язык программирования]" с главой "базы данных"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:13 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
jnub, это логично конечно, однако программисты советуют как раз таки наоборот не читать книжки, а учиться вживую, пробовать писать с постепенным набором сложности, а информации и в интернете море. Хотелось бы получить ответ от живых людей. Ведь форум как раз предназначен для помощи новичкам?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:21 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
fargutvest, Вы начинаете не с того конца.. Чтобы понять какая нужна структура бд, нужно знать какие задачи она будет решать. Вы же не просто так хотите сохранять все эти данные ? Наверно в итоге хочется получить какую-нибудь статистику типа какие устройства чаще ломаются, какие реже, типы поломок, сроки починки и тд и тп Вот после того как Вы с этим определитесь, можно подумать о том какие данные для этого нужны и в каком виде сохранять их в таблицах. А пока цель не определена бессмысленно рассуждать про средства.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:28 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
fargutvestjnub, это логично конечно, однако программисты советуют как раз таки наоборот не читать книжки, а учиться вживую, пробовать писать с постепенным набором сложности, а информации и в интернете море. Хотелось бы получить ответ от живых людей. Ведь форум как раз предназначен для помощи новичкам? не надо слушать таких "программистов". fargutvestПравильно ли будет сделать что-то типа справочника в котором будут разновидности неисправностей, ремонта, годы, состояния пломбы... и т.д. , каждой записи присвоить уникальный код. И чтоб в базе хранились эти соответствующие коды. таки да, правильно ну возможно окромя "годы, состояния пломбы"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:29 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
Gwa, именно для этих целей база и создается, она даже существует уже в виде екселевского файла. Просто в экселе неудобно делать соритровку. Из базы будут делаться выборки для статистики по ремонту, по датам, по типам неисправностей. А на данном этапе хочу определиться как всетаки правильно хранить в базе записи или коды записей.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:40 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
m7mfargutvestПравильно ли будет сделать что-то типа справочника в котором будут разновидности неисправностей, ремонта, годы, состояния пломбы... и т.д. , каждой записи присвоить уникальный код. И чтоб в базе хранились эти соответствующие коды. таки да, правильно ну возможно окромя "годы, состояния пломбы" Cостояния пломбы: Нет Есть Есть, но покоцанная(возможно снималась) Чужая пломба ... и т.п. Я бы сделал справочник, или текстовое поле с доп.пометками "Состояние пломбы"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:42 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
fargutvestGwa, именно для этих целей база и создается, она даже существует уже в виде екселевского файла. Просто в экселе неудобно делать соритровку. Из базы будут делаться выборки для статистики по ремонту, по датам, по типам неисправностей. А на данном этапе хочу определиться как всетаки правильно хранить в базе записи или коды записей. Вам правильно советуют почитать книжки.. БД строится вообще говоря по сущностям. Берёте Вашу предметную область, думаете какие она имеет сущности. Каждая сущность -отдельная таблица. А свалить всё в одну таблицу (в кучу) -это в Вас говорит экселевское представление, в БД так делать не надо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:45 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
NetObserverm7mпропущено... таки да, правильно ну возможно окромя "годы, состояния пломбы" Cостояния пломбы: Нет Есть Есть, но покоцанная(возможно снималась) Чужая пломба следом возникнет вопрос "кто ставил эту пломбу???" :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:46 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
fargutvestjnub, это логично конечно, однако программисты советуют как раз таки наоборот не читать книжки, а учиться вживую, пробовать писать с постепенным набором сложности , а информации и в интернете море. Хотелось бы получить ответ от живых людей. Ведь форум как раз предназначен для помощи новичкам? выделенное от Вас никуда не уйдет всё это Вы пройдёте просто имеет смысл заранее окунуться в теорию чтобы потом стыдно не было зы. хотя стыдно всё равно будет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:48 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
книжки это ж еще и терминология будете знать, чем первичный ключ отличается от вторичного, а суррогатный от естественного ;)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:50 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
jnub, ясно, наверное вы правы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 17:52 |
|
||
|
Нужен совет, что будет "правилом хорошего тона" ? (заполнеие базы данных)
|
|||
|---|---|---|---|
|
#18+
NetObserverm7mпропущено... таки да, правильно ну возможно окромя "годы, состояния пломбы" Cостояния пломбы: Нет Есть Есть, но покоцанная(возможно снималась) Чужая пломба ... и т.п. Я бы сделал справочник, или текстовое поле с доп.пометками "Состояние пломбы" Ну судя вот по этому "4.наличие пломбы (есть/нет)" интересует просто наличие пломбы и справочник на это не нужен а в остальном согласен 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 12.03.2013, 23:47 |
|
||
|
|

start [/forum/topic.php?fid=32&fpage=40&tid=1541340]: |
0ms |
get settings: |
8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
32ms |
get topic data: |
12ms |
get forum data: |
4ms |
get page messages: |
33ms |
get tp. blocked users: |
1ms |
| others: | 208ms |
| total: | 317ms |

| 0 / 0 |
